Be Fit Malaysians #18: Athletic Performance Amidst A Pandemic

The 2020 Olympics has been postponed to next year and many other sporting events and tournaments have also been cancelled or put on hold. Gyms and training centres are also shut due to the pandemic and the MCO, so how can athletes - both amateur and professional - maintain athleticism and their fitness during this time? And what happens if they don’t? Consultant orthopaedic surgeon Dr Harjeet Singh joins us for his insights.
